Specifically, the servo drive 4 includes servo motor 41, lead screw 42 and axle sleeve 43, the servo motor 41
Mounted on 1 right side of rack, 42 right end of the lead screw is connected with 41 output end of servo motor, and 42 left end of the lead screw passes through axle sleeve 43
It is fixed on 1 left side of rack;Lead screw 42 is driven to rotate by servo motor 41, the guide block 5 controlled on lead screw 42 moves left and right.
Specifically, offering the sliding rail 61 to match with sliding block 6 in the rack 1;The sliding rail 61 to match is set, it is convenient
Sliding block 6 slides in rack 1.
Specifically, the tumbler 8 includes driving motor 81, main shaft 82 and belt 83,82 lower rotation of the main shaft
It is connected to connecting plate 7, is sequentially connected by belt 83 between the output shaft and main shaft 82 of the driving motor 81;By driving electricity
Machine 81 drives main shaft 82 to rotate, and realizes that main shaft 82 drives turntable 9 to rotate.
Specifically, corresponding first push plate 16 position that is slidably connected offers the sliding slot to match on the turntable 9, convenient for the
One push plate 16 is slided.
Specifically, the bearing plate 12 and turntable 9 are all made of stainless steel plate structure, and surface is all covered with non-slip mat;Using
Stainless steel plate structure, structural strength is high, and covering non-slip mat can improve the skid resistance on 9 surface of bearing plate 12 and turntable.
Operation principle:In use, the mold of auto parts and components casting is placed on bearing plate 12, pass through the second cylinder 11
It drives bearing plate 12 to be lifted, while the servo drive 4 in rack 1 works, drives guide block 5 to slide to the left, work as load-bearing
Plate 12 it is concordant with turntable 9 merging on one wire when, by third cylinder 13 push the second push plate 14 push casting mould to turn
On disk 9, rack 1 is transferred to melting furnace discharge side, controlling guide block 5 by servo drive 4 moves, and drives on turntable 9
Casting mould movement adjustment, and by tumbler 8 drive turntable 9 rotate, adjust to suitable position and cast, cast
Cheng Hou, turntable are transferred to left side, drive the first push plate 16 that casting mould is pushed to bearing plate 12 again by the first cylinder 15
On, the mold cast is transferred away, mechanized operation mode saves manpower.
